What Are Prescription-Free Drugs?
Prescription-free drugs are medications that can be purchased without a prescription. These drugs are thought about safe and efficient for treating minor health issues when used according to the directions provided. They are normally categorized into 2 main categories:

-
OTC (Over-The-Counter) Medications: These are drugs that can be bought directly from pharmacies, grocery stores, and other retail outlets. They are usually utilized for the treatment of mild disorders, such as headaches, colds, or allergic reactions.
-
Dietary Supplements: These include vitamins, minerals, herbs, and other dietary supplements. While they are not drugs in the conventional sense, they offer health advantages and can be purchased without a prescription.

Threats and Considerations
While prescription-free drugs included numerous advantages, users need to likewise exercise caution. Here are some prospective risks:
-
Misuse: Individuals may misuse OTC medications, causing adverse effects or drug interactions.
-
Self-Diagnosis: Relying on self-diagnosis can cause incorrect treatment choices and possibly get worse health concerns.
-
Negative effects: Even OTC medications can trigger side impacts or allergies, particularly if consumers do not read the labels carefully.
-
Inadequate Treatment: Some conditions may require prescription medications for efficient treatment, and ignoring this can result in complications.
-
Overuse: Frequent reliance on certain medications, like Purchase Pain Relievers relievers, can result in tolerance or dependence.
How to Use Prescription-Free Drugs Safely
To make the most of the advantages and decrease the threats connected with prescription-free drugs, consider the following guidelines:
-
Read Labels Carefully: Understand the dose, active ingredients, and any possible adverse effects.
-
Consult a Healthcare Provider: If unsure about a medication or if symptoms continue, look for professional medical guidance.
-
Understand Interactions: Keep track of all medications (consisting of OTC and supplements) being taken to prevent hazardous interactions.
-
Follow Dosage Instructions: Stick to recommended dosages and schedules to avoid overuse.
-
Screen Symptoms: Be alert about any negative effects or modifications in health; cease use and speak with a physician if concerns arise.
FAQ About Prescription-Free Drugs
1. Are all over the counter drugs safe for everyone?
While many OTC drugs are safe when utilized as directed, some may not be appropriate for pregnant people, people with particular health conditions, or those taking particular medications. Constantly speak with a health care expert if uncertain.
2. Can prescription-free drugs interact with prescription medications?
Yes, numerous OTC Buying Drugs Online Legally can connect with prescription medications, potentially causing negative results. It is vital to inform health care providers about all medications being taken.
3. How do I know if an OTC drug is best for my symptoms?
Understanding your symptoms and investigating proper OTC alternatives can help. However, consulting a pharmacist or health care provider for recommendations is always beneficial.
4. Are dietary supplements considered safe?
The majority of dietary supplements are usually safe, however their efficacy can differ. It is crucial to research products and talk to a health care provider, especially for those with pre-existing health conditions.
5. Is it essential to keep an eye on the expiration dates of OTC drugs?
Yes, expired medications might lose their effectiveness and could potentially be damaging. Routinely examine expiration dates and securely dispose of ended products.
